Joan Brehl lands at ABC Canada
Industry veteran Joan Brehl, who lost her job as publishing director of Time Canada when the magazine was closed in December, has landed a new gig as vice president/general manager of the Audit Bureau of Circulations’ Canadian division.

Joan Brehl receiving the Ad Club Award of Merit in 2007.
Brehl, who spent 18 years at Time and has also worked in advertising and magazine editorial, will officially begin work at ABC on Aug. 4, though she will attend a couple of board meetings in Toronto and Chicago this month.

According to a press release from ABC:
Her focus includes implementation of marketing and sales strategies that promote the ABC Canada brand, developing new strategic business opportunities in print, digital, mobile and other media channels, and forging relationships with Canada’s leading publishers, media buyers, and industry influencers. Brehl will also serve as the staff liaison for the newly formed ABC Canada Board Committee and its advisory committees—the Canadian Newspaper Advisory Committee and the Canadian Print Advertising Buyers Committee.
Brehl is essentially replacing Bob White, ABC’s former senior vice president of Canada, who split with the organization earlier this year. White, who specializes in sales and marketing, as well as association management, told Masthead today that he’s still looking for work in the industry.
